Khutsong author hopes debut book will inspire young people

Twenty-year-old Bonolo Refentse Menoe will launch Unleash Your Potential in September, sharing her personal journey to encourage resilience and hope.

 A young resident of Khutsong has decided to take a positive step to motivate others by launching her debut book.

Bonolo Refentse Menoe (20) is releasing her book, Unleash Your Potential, on September 26.

The book focuses on motivation and education, drawing from Menoe’s own experiences as a young girl. “The book is to help other kids out there overcome suicide,” says Menoe.

She hopes to inspire readers with the message that a person’s background does not define their future. Menoe, who was raised by unemployed parents in the dusty streets of Khutsong, has already built a Christian brand called F8THFUL EXPRESSIONS.

She views becoming an author as the next step in a journey of self-discovery, revealing gifts that she feels were always inside her.

She shared that writing the book was not a struggle because it is deeply personal, focusing entirely on her own life, challenges, and achievements.

The official book launch will take place at the Christian Assembly Church International in Khutsong Ext 4.
